[vdr] channels.conf modified



Hi,
I have added one entry in my vdr's channels.conf to watch an anolog channel. I live in Italy(PAL)and my WinTv card is on /dev/video1. The line added is as follow:

Rai Due:519250:B6C12D0:C:0:160:80:0:A0:65000:0:0:0
----------------------^^^^^^^^---------------------------------------

When I start VDR (vdr -P analogtv -d) I find out that my channels.conf has been modified...the added line results as

Rai Due:519250:C12D0B6:C:0:160:80:0:A0:65000:0:0:0
----------------------^^^^^^^^---------------------------------------

The NORM, CAPTURE DEVICE, VIDEO SOURCE parameters have been altered. I can't watch my analog channel. Is it the right behaviour or such a run-time modification is wrong?
